Sun Dried Tomato Creamy Asiago Chicken

Creamy asiago chicken pasta loaded with sun dried tomatoes, tender chicken, fresh spinach, and a rich velvety sauce that wraps around every bite of penne pasta. This comforting skillet dinner is packed with savory flavor and comes together in just 45 minutes.

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 12 ounces penne pasta
  • 1 1/2 pounds boneless skinless chicken thighs
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 3/4 cup sun dried tomatoes, sliced
  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up chicken broth
  • 1 1/2 cups asiago cheese, freshly grated
  • 2 cups fresh spinach
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)

Instructions

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the penne pasta until al dente. Reserve 1/2 cup pasta water, then drain.
  2. Season the chicken thighs with salt, black pepper, and Italian seasoning.
  3.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Sear the chicken for 5 to 6 minutes per side until golden brown and fully cooked. Remove from the skillet and slice into bite sized pieces.
  4. In the same skillet, sauté the garlic and sun dried tomatoes for 1 minute until fragrant.
  5. Pour in the chicken broth and heavy cream. Stir well and let the mixture simmer gently.
  6. Add the freshly grated asiago cheese gradually, stirring continuously until the sauce becomes smooth and creamy.
  7. Stir in the spinach and let it wilt into the sauce.
  8. Add the cooked pasta and sliced chicken back into the skillet. Toss until evenly coated. Add reserved pasta water if needed to loosen the sauce.
  9. Sprinkle fresh basil and optional red pepper flakes over the top before serving.
  10. Serve hot with extra asiago cheese if desired.

Notes

  • Freshly grated asiago cheese melts more smoothly than pre shredded cheese.
  • Do not boil the cream sauce aggressively to prevent separation.
  • Add extra chicken broth when reheating leftovers to keep the sauce creamy.
  • Rigatoni or fettuccine can be used instead of penne pasta.
